Automatic Milk Measurement and Flow Control by using Embedded System

Abstract: This paper focused on system to automate the process of measuring milk in tank and flow control of water. In milk measuring system we use Ultrasonic sensor to sense level of milk and microcontroller to calculate the distance between milk level and receiver by time of span method. LCD is used to display the milk level in terms of liters and percentage. If the milk level is above the specific level of milk tank then control valve is OFF so stop the milk entering. If the milk level is below the specific level of milk tank then control valve is ON. In water flow control, we use capacitive proximity sensor. It can sense not only conductor or metallic material but also non-conductor. The sensing distance depends upon distance. In this flow control system, if the milk can is present in front of pipe or tap of water, then motor is ON by changing the capacitance value and if milk can is not present then motor is OFF.
